Tony Award winner and Broadway star Idina Menzel is in negotiations to appear on the last nine episodes that will round up the first season of “Glee.”
The show will take a mid-season break starting next week and will resume in April next year.
Menzel, who is known for playing Elphaba on the Broadway musical “Wicked” and Maureen on the Broadway and big-screen adaptation of “Rent,” has admitted that she is an avid fan of the Fox musical TV show.
Followers of Glee have noticed Idina’s resemblance to Lea Michele, who plays Rachel Berry on the show, and have been wondering if she is going to be cast as Michele’s biological mother.
But the producers have said that if everything pushes through, Menzel will appear as the choir director for a rival glee club called Vocal Adrenaline.
Just recently, Glee did a cover of “Defying Gravity,” a song that Menzel sang as Elphaba on Wicked.
Another Wicked star, Kristin Chenoweth (Glinda), appeared on an earlier episode of Glee this season.
